Result: Richard McEvoy wins first PGA European Tour title

Englishman Richard McEvoy follows up his Le Vaudreuil Golf Challenge triumph with victory in the Porsche European Open in Hamburg.

Richard McEvoy has lifted his maiden PGA European Tour title with victory at the Porsche European Open.

The 39-year-old Englishman, who also won the Le Vaudreuil Golf Challenge in France seven days ago, sunk a 20-foot putt at the 18th to claim a one-shot triumph.

Renato Paratore, Christofer Blomstrand and Allen John all ended one stroke behind in a tight finish at the Green Eagle Golf Courses in Hamburg.

McEvoy, who started the day in a share of the lead, closed with a round of 73 for an 11-under total, while John's five-under for the day - including six birdies - saw him fall just short.

Bryson DeChambeau, level with McEvoy at the start of the final round, hit four bogies and was three over par on the last hole to finish five off the pace.

PORSCHE EUROPEAN OPEN LEADERBOARD

1. Richard McEvoy (-11)
2. Christofer Blomstrand (-10)
2. Allen John (-10)
2. Renato Paratore (-10)
5. Hideto Tanihara (-9)
5. Romain Wattel (-9)
